Mitsubishi Outlander vs Kia Sportage Mechanical Specs

Confident composure is the core of Outlander’s chassis tuning. A MacPherson strut front suspension and multi-link rear help the SUV track straight and true, absorb patchy tarmac, and settle quickly after bigger bumps, all while keeping body motions in check. Braking hardware is robust, with ventilated discs front and rear paired to ABS with Electronic Brakeforce Distribution and Brake Assist. Trailer Stability Assist comes standard to help reduce sway while towing, and Tire Pressure Monitoring with Tire Fill Notification adds day-to-day peace of mind. On S-AWC models, selectable drive modes — including Tarmac, Gravel, Snow, Normal, Eco and, on certain trims, Mud — tailor the vehicle’s responses to conditions, from slick on-ramps to rutted lanes. The steering’s quick ratio and tidy turning circle make quick work of tight parking decks around destinations near Wilmington, DE, while the available 360° multi-view camera system provides a helpful birds-eye perspective in crowded lots. The Kia Sportage counters with available torque-vectoring AWD and a Multi-Terrain Mode selector (mud, sand, snow on certain trims), plus a capable suspension tune for its class. Still, Outlander’s tuning, standard 11 airbags, and trail-ready Trail Edition depth create a distinctly secure and composed feel in more scenarios.

Powertrain – Mitsubishi Dealership near Wilmington, DE

Under the hood, Outlander’s 1.5L MIVEC DOHC turbocharged 4-cylinder with direct injection teams with a 48V-BSG mild-hybrid system to enhance response and smoothness. Output is a confident 174 hp and 206 lb-ft of torque, channeled through a continuously variable transmission refined for everyday drivability. The mild-hybrid assist contributes to crisp launches from stoplights, lights up low-speed maneuvering, and helps the engine stay in its sweet spot more often. With available S-AWC, torque distribution and brake-based control elevate traction and balance in low-grip moments, while selectable modes let drivers emphasize efficiency or confidence as needs change. Outlander’s 2,000-pound towing capacity (properly equipped) covers small trailers, lightweight campers, and home-improvement hauls. The Kia Sportage, by comparison, features a 2.5-liter 4-cylinder with an 8-speed automatic and available AWD, plus trims that deliver mud, snow, and sand modes for variable conditions. It also offers available hybrid and plug-in hybrid variants in its broader lineup. Safety – Mitsubishi Outlander vs Kia Sportage

Outlander’s comprehensive safety suite starts with structure and extends to sophisticated sensors and software. Standard features include Forward Collision Mitigation with Pedestrian Detection, Blind Spot Warning with Lane Change Assist, Rear Cross Traffic Alert, Rear Automatic Emergency Braking, and more. Standard 11 airbags — including a front center airbag and rear outboard seat-mounted side airbags — set a high bar in this class. The available 360° multi-view camera system takes the guesswork out of tight maneuvers, while MI-PILOT Assist™ with Navi-link (on select trims) supports speed and lane position on well-marked roads, and can proactively adjust cruising speed for upcoming curves or changes based on navigation data. Mitsubishi Connect with Safeguard and Remote Services includes a 24-month trial (mobile app enrollment required) and keeps owners confidently connected. The Kia Sportage answers with a wide-ranging driver assistance list, including Auto Emergency Braking with Junction Turning Detection, Blind-Spot Collision-Avoidance Assist, available Rear Cross-Traffic Collision-Avoidance Assist, available 360° Surround View Monitor, and available Highway Driving Assist.
